What You’ll Need
Gather These Simple Ingredients:
- 2 large flour tortillas
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up diced onions
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 2 tablespoons ketchup
- 1 tablespoon mustard
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cooking oil for frying
Step-by-Step Instructions
Let’s Make It Together:
In a sk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ef until browned. Drain any excess fat and season generously with salt and pepper. The savory aroma filling your kitchen will make everyone curious about what you’re cooking!
In another bowl, mix mayonnaise, ketchup, and mustard to create a special sauce. Give it a taste, and marvel at how the flavors meld together into something downright delightful.
Place one tortilla in a clean skillet over medium heat. Layer half of the cooked ground beef, half of the onions, half of the tomatoes, and half of the cheese on one half of the tortilla. It’s like creating a delicious masterpiece!
Fold the tortilla over to create a half-moon shape. Cook until golden brown and the cheese is melted, about 3-4 minutes on each side. The anticipation builds as you hear that satisfying crunch!
Repeat with the second tortilla, letting the mouthwatering smell fill your home once more.
Cut into wedges and serve with the special sauce, and watch them disappear in a flash!

Chef Emma’s Helpful Tips
- Make-Ahead Advice: Cook the ground beef in advance and store it in the fridge, so you can whip these up in a hurry on a busy night.
- Ingredient Swaps: Don’t have mayonnaise? Try yogurt or sour cream for a tangy variation in your sauce.
- Slicing Tricks: To cut quesadillas neatly, use a pizza cutter for effortlessly divided wedges.
- Storage Suggestions: Keep any leftovers in the fridge for up to three days; just reheat on a skillet for the best texture!

Smashburger Quesadillas
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: 2 quesadillas 1x
- Diet: None specified
Description
Enjoy the comforting flavors of Smashburger Quesadillas, filled with seasoned beef and gooey cheese, perfect for family weeknight dinners.
Ingredients
- 2 large flour tortillas
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up diced onions
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 2 tablespoons ketchup
- 1 tablespoon mustard
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cooking oil for frying
Instructions
- In a sk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ef until browned. Drain any excess fat and season generously with salt and pepper.
- In another bowl, mix mayonnaise, ketchup, and mustard to create a special sauce.
- Place one tortilla in a clean skillet over medium heat. Layer half of the cooked ground beef, half of the onions, half of the tomatoes, and half of the cheese on one half of the tortilla.
- Fold the tortilla over to create a half-moon shape. Cook until golden brown and the cheese is melted, about 3-4 minutes on each side.
- Repeat with the second tortilla.
- Cut into wedges and serve with the special sauce.
Notes
Make ahead by cooking the ground beef in advance. Use a pizza cutter for neat wedges.
